Are you going to change the name of
Blighia becuse Admiral Bligh was a convicted sadist?
That's an inaccurate example based on the fictional movie versions of
Mutiny on the Bounty. Historians have found that Bligh used less
physical punishment than other ship captains of his era. Bligh was
never convicted of sadism.
Caroline Alexander's recent book and several others make it clear that
Bligh was a hero, not the villain, in the Bounty mutiny. If not for
Bligh's sailing skills, he and the loyal crew set adrift by Fletcher
Christian would have perished. Christian sent Bligh and the others to
what he thought was a certain death. He and the other mutineers were
the villains.
